NFL’s Alcohol Policy Under Scrutiny Amidst Surge in Violent Incidents

The National Football League (NFL) is facing growing scrutiny as the number of violent incidents at stadiums continues to surge this season. Experts are now pointing towards the alcohol allowed at stadiums as a possible contributing factor to the problem. While the NFL claims that safety is a top priority, critics argue that more needs to be done to address the issue.

Recent events have highlighted the severity of the problem. During a Monday night football game, a physical altercation broke out between a couple of Bills fans, and although it remains unclear if any injuries were sustained or if security was involved, the incident raises serious concerns. Similarly, at SoFi Stadium, a fight erupted between a Chargers fan and a Raiders fan, further adding to the growing list of violent confrontations. In September, two women were captured fighting during a 49ers game at Levi’s Stadium, emphasizing the need for interventions to mitigate such incidents.

Scripps News has attempted to reach out to the NFL for comment regarding the rising number of fights but has yet to receive a response. However, last month, the NFL stated to the Daily Mail Sport that safety is of utmost importance and expressed disgust towards the disruptive behavior of a small number of fans who interfere with the enjoyment of others.

The NFL implemented a fan code of conduct in 2008 to foster an enjoyable stadium environment for all attendees. It explicitly states that fans who violate the code may lose ticket privileges for future games. Unruly, disruptive, or illegal behavior is strictly prohibited under these guidelines.

Obie Bryant, the president and CEO of Bryant Safety and Security, stresses the importance of proactive measures. Bryant emphasizes that security personnel should actively patrol the crowd, promptly responding to signs of potential disturbances, and diverting officers to specific areas within stadiums when necessary. According to Bryant, the combination of emotional football games and a lack of conflict resolution skills, amplified by alcohol consumption, creates a volatile situation.

According to a survey conducted by Sportsbook Review, nearly 40% of NFL fans have observed crimes, including physical violence and public intoxication, occurring at or around NFL stadiums. Troublingly, the survey further reveals that 45% of women feel unsafe attending an NFL game alone, while 77% of parents would not allow their children to attend a game without adult supervision.

While the NFL has made efforts to enhance security and prevent unruly behavior, the persisting incidents raise questions about the effectiveness of their approach. Striking a balance between safety and an enjoyable fan experience is crucial for the league’s reputation and the well-being of attendees. It remains to be seen whether the NFL will implement stricter alcohol policies or introduce additional security measures to address the escalating problem.
